I just bought 5 Milestar Patagonia M/T tires from Walmart yesterday, arriving later today, for ~$162/tire, with free shipping. Walmart, like Amazon, will sell products that come from other companies. Other external companies through Walmart wanted ~$220/tire for the 285/70R17.
The 285/70R17 is a 33”, so not a 35”. My A/T 33” tires just fit under my 4R, so I was afraid to try the 315/70R17, the 35” version. The 295 was ~$238/tire and 33.5”, so I got the 285.
Every now and then, Walmart has some great deals!
UPDATE: The tires arrived this morning, and I ordered them at around 6pm yesterday. I was worried that the tires would be old, but they were all manufactured in June, 2021 (2421 DOT codes on all 5 tires). I also confirmed that all five tires are 285/70R17, the size I ordered.
